from uitest.framework import UITestCase
from libreoffice.calc.document import get_cell_by_position
from libreoffice.uno.propertyvalue import mkPropertyValues
from uitest.uihelper.common import select_pos
class CellDropDownItems(UITestCase):
def test_dropdownitems(self):
#This is to test Dropdown items in grid window
with self.ui_test.create_doc_in_start_center("calc") as document:
xCalcDoc = self.xUITest.getTopFocusWindow()
gridwin = xCalcDoc.getChild("grid_window")
#select cell C10
gridwin.executeAction("SELECT", mkPropertyValues({"CELL": "C10"}))
#Open Validation Dialog
with self.ui_test.execute_dialog_through_command(".uno:Validation") as xDialog:
#Select List option
xallow = xDialog.getChild("allow")
select_pos(xallow, "6")
#Add items to the List
xminlist = xDialog.getChild("minlist")
xminlist.executeAction("TYPE", mkPropertyValues({"TEXT": "Item1"}))
xminlist.executeAction("TYPE", mkPropertyValues({"KEYCODE": "RETURN"}))
xminlist.executeAction("TYPE", mkPropertyValues({"TEXT": "Item2"}))
xminlist.executeAction("TYPE", mkPropertyValues({"KEYCODE": "RETURN"}))
xminlist.executeAction("TYPE", mkPropertyValues({"TEXT": "Item3"}))
xminlist.executeAction("TYPE", mkPropertyValues({"KEYCODE": "RETURN"}))
xminlist.executeAction("TYPE", mkPropertyValues({"TEXT": "Item4"}))
xminlist.executeAction("TYPE", mkPropertyValues({"KEYCODE": "RETURN"}))
xminlist.executeAction("TYPE", mkPropertyValues({"TEXT": "Item5"}))
#Close the dialog
#Launch the Select Menu to view the list ans select first item in the list
gridwin = xCalcDoc.getChild("grid_window")
gridwin.executeAction("LAUNCH", mkPropertyValues({"SELECTMENU": "", "COL": "2", "ROW": "9"}))
#Select the TreeList UI Object
xWin = self.xUITest.getTopFocusWindow()
xlist = xWin.getChild("list")
xListItem = xlist.getChild('0')
xListItem.executeAction("DOUBLECLICK" , mkPropertyValues({}) )
self.assertEqual(get_cell_by_position(document, 0, 2, 9).getString(), "Item1")
#Launch the Select Menu to view the list ans select Third item in the list
gridwin = xCalcDoc.getChild("grid_window")
gridwin.executeAction("LAUNCH", mkPropertyValues({"SELECTMENU": "", "COL": "2", "ROW": "9"}))
#Select the TreeList UI Object
xWin = self.xUITest.getTopFocusWindow()
xlist = xWin.getChild("list")
xListItem = xlist.getChild('2')
xListItem.executeAction("DOUBLECLICK" , mkPropertyValues({}) )
self.assertEqual(get_cell_by_position(document, 0, 2, 9).getString(), "Item3")
#Launch the Select Menu to view the list ans select Fifth item in the list
gridwin = xCalcDoc.getChild("grid_window")
gridwin.executeAction("LAUNCH", mkPropertyValues({"SELECTMENU": "", "COL": "2", "ROW": "9"}))
#Select the TreeList UI Object
xWin = self.xUITest.getTopFocusWindow()
xlist = xWin.getChild("list")
xListItem = xlist.getChild('4')
xListItem.executeAction("DOUBLECLICK" , mkPropertyValues({}) )
self.assertEqual(get_cell_by_position(document, 0, 2, 9).getString(), "Item5")
